Karora Resources Inc T.KRR

Alternate Symbol(s):  KRRGF

Karora Resources Inc. is a Canada-based multi-asset mineral resource company. The Company’s portfolio includes the Beta Hunt Underground Mine, Higginsville Gold Operations and Lakewood Mill. It owns 100% of Beta Hunt, a gold-producing mine located approximately 600 kilometers from Perth in Kambalda, Western Australia. It owns and operates HGO, which is located approximately 75 kilometers south of the Beta Hunt Mine in Higginsville, Western Australia. HGO has a mineral gold resource and reserve and prospective land package totaling approximately 1,900 square kilometers. The operation includes a 1.6 million tons per annum (Mtpa) processing plant, 192 mining tenements, including the Aquarius, Hidden Secret, Mousehollow, Two Boys, Baloo, Pioneer, Fairplay North, Mitchell, Wills, Challenge and Mount Henry deposits. The Lakewood Gold Mill is located just outside Kalgoorlie, Western Australia and approximately 60 kilometers from the Beta Hunt Mine, has a processing capacity of 1.0 Mtpa.

RE:Anybody have any theories

RE:Anybody have any theories

Today SP lost almost 12%. That's in addition to previous days of losses.

One of the reasons (not for the drop but for the drop bigger than other gold miners) is far from stellar Q1 report. Another is a continuing PoG drop. But, again, it affects all gold miners. And one very specific reason for Karora is that it moved too high too fast .That was great of course but the expected correction in KRR SP to some reasonable levels, say mid $6, coincided with big correction in the PoG and overall market decline. KRR SP has a room to go down. Even at today's closing price and after losing 1/3 of it's peak value around $7.50 it still around 65% above its 52 weeks low of ~$3.0. At the same time many gold miners are setting new 52week lows in the past few days.

With this in mind I can say that in my view Karora is a much better investment among junior gold miners since it's great performance before PoG correction started demonstrated that the market values this stock. Just my 2 cents.
